**14:22 — Audit-log viewer degradation begins.** For new folks: Ledgerpane is our internal audit-log viewer, maintained by the Trailmark team. At 14:22 the pagination service started returning duplicate pages after a schema migration landed mid-deploy. Users at Corvid Analytics reported frozen scroll views within six minutes. Rollback completed at 14:51 and duplicates cleared from cache by 15:10. The offending migration shipped in a build whose trace token is recorded below for reference.

trace token, kawip-fafog: htk14_26e64c4d35154e

Heads up before the Fenwick rollout: the `/pricing/experiments` endpoint now supports the new tiered-ticket test for Orbithall events. Pass `experiment=tiergate` to get variant pricing back in the response payload — otherwise you'll just see baseline fares. Rate limits are generous but not infinite, so batch your calls. To authenticate against the internal Ledgerline service, use the key below.

gateway credential: kto3_qfe

Welcome to on-call for the Glimmerpane design system! Our snapshot tests live in the `snapcheck` suite and run on every merge to main. If a UI component changes visually, the diff bot flags it — usually it's an intentional tweak, so just approve the new baseline. If it's 2am and snapshots are failing across the board, it's almost always a font-loading race, not your problem. To unlock the baseline store and re-approve snapshots in bulk, use the recovery passphrase below.

recovery phrase for tahag-taguf: wenix-caswyn